So, after being here a few months, I think the following features would be a nice addition:
A Blog page for each user in which they can showcase their projects
A list of source code and other such resources (tutorials, game design mantras, etc) that can be submitted by the forum users
It would also be nice if something could be done to attract volunteer artists.
I don't expect these things, but I would personally like them. But maybe I'm the only one.